Abstract :
Maintaining comfortable thermal conditions in an office environment is very important, as it can affect the quality of life of the occupants, their work productivity, and improve energy efficiency. One significant aspect of this task is how to balance the preferences of a number of occupants sharing the same space. We suggest three families of approaches to this problem, both for the case of optimising for a single time period, and for the problem of optimising over multiple different time periods. We analyse in detail the different approaches based on a number of natural properties, proving which of the properties the different families satisfy.
